By Sarah N. Lynch and Andrew Goudsward
WASHINGTON (Reuters) -The Trump administration has fired four additional FBI agents who worked on former Special Counsel Jack Smith’s team investigating efforts to overturn the 2020 presidential election results, four people familiar with the matter told Reuters.
The move is the latest in a string of personnel actions targeting employees who worked on probes looking into President Donald Trump or his allies.
